The Super Perfekt stands as a tribute to Meindl's centuries-old tradition of precision boot making. Built in the classical form and held to uncompromising standards, this boot reflects the kind of craftsmanship that's nearly vanished in modern footwear. Every detail is intentional. The upper is crafted from a single piece of military-grade cowhide - seamless across the front for strength, with a single rear seam protected by a rugged leather overlay. This minimal seam construction isn't just for aesthetics; it ensures lasting durability and protection. The triple-stitched Norwegian welt is a defining Meindl hallmark - sturdy, resolute, and made to be resoled again and again. Inside, a full leather lining paired with the Air-Active® Soft Print Drysole provides comfort that adapts over time, forming to your foot like a custom fit. Beneath, the Vibram® Montagna sole delivers time-tested reliability, while the D-rated midsole offers the stiffness of a true alpine boot - classic in design, uncompromising in performance. At 8.5" tall and uninsulated, the Super Perfekt isn't built for trends. It's built the Meindl way: with care, skill, and with the kind of enduring quality you don't see every day. Made with pride. Worn with purpose. Made in Germany

At Meindl we know that quality boots are a significant investment. That is why we are so committed to educating our customers on the best methods of care to make sure your boots continue to perform at their peak and last for years to come.
All Meindl Boots come out of the factory treated and ready for you to get out. However, if you want to ensure the boots are in peak condition from the moment you hit the field you can give them a quick treatment with our Meindl Wet Proof and let that sit for 24 hours and then apply Meindl Sport Wax.
IMPORTANT: DO NOT heat Sport Wax before applying. Doing so can cause it to penetrate too deep and impair the leather’s breathability and wearing comfort. DO NOT apply oils or grease on any of our boots. There are two reasons: First, oil and grease products can cause boots to lose strength and stability. Second, oil or grease will migrate throughout the leather which can cause the rand and outsoles to delaminate from the boot.
